In two seasons (28 games) Josh Morgan has 72 receptions for 846 yards and 6 TDs. They're not terrible numbers, but they're not great either. They break down to 2.5 receptions and 30 yards per game with a less than 25% chance of catching a TD pass. In fact, he should have 2 more TDs on that tally, but he dropped one wide open TD pass from Hill and got caught on what looked to be a sure TD against the Falcons last season because he didn't finish his run to the endzone. In Week 1 of the 2008 season he also alligator armed a TD pass from O'Sullivan at Seattle, but I forgave him because it was his first game.

As for Joe Nedney, why is it ridiculous to look for another kicker? Neil Rackers was cut by the Cardinals last season. He was 16/17 from FG range, with his lone miss coming from beyond 40 yards. Meanwhile, Joe Nedney was 17/21, with one of those misses coming from just over 30 yards. Rackers isn't great at kicking the ball off either, but he is better than Nedney. I understand that it is harder to make FGs in SF than most places, but I'm sure Rackers and many other kickers are up to the task. And as I said in the OP of the Nedney thread, he has admitted to suffering from severe pain in his kicking leg. Doesn't it seem like his time is running thin?
